Steel, Kenneth C. was born on August 17, 1963 in Tuscaloosa, Alabama, United States.

University of Florida (Bachelor of Science in Business Administration, 1985. Juris Doctor, with honors, 1992).
Worked at Spohrer Wilner Maxwell Maciejewski & Stanford & Matthews, P.A. (Jacksonville, Florida) specializing in Personal Injury, Toxic Tort Law, Aviation Law, Commercial Law, Corporate Law, Products Liability, Pharmaceutical Law. Admitted to the bar, 1993, Florida. Member, Order of the Barristers.
Recipient: American Jurisprudence Award, Remedies.
Book Awards, Remedies and Legal Drafting. College of Law Alumni Council Community Service Award.
Company-Author: "Litigation Procedure in Age Discrimination Cases", Section 111, Chapter 14, Employment Discrimination Law, 3rd Edition, Paul Cane and Barry Goldstein, Editors-in-Chief, 1993. Teaching Fellow, Legal Research and Writing, 1991-1992.
Assistant State Attorney, 7th Circuit, Florida, 1994-1996.
Member: Jacksonville Bar Association. Volusia Young Lawyers Association (Board of Directors, 1995-1996). The firm was founded in 1991 by Robert F. Spohrer and Norwood South.
